过去的HTML 已经难以满足现代 Web 应用的需要,事实上,这个协议已经有超过 10 年没有更新了。HTML5 的出现旨在解决 Web 中的交互,媒体,本地操作等问题,一些浏览器已经尝试支持 HTM
顺晟科技
2021-06-16 10:45:55
209
Web前端开发工程师主要负责利用(X)HTML/CSS/JavaScript/Flash等各种Web技术开发客户端产品。完成客户端程序(即浏览器)的开发,开发JavaScript和Flash模块,用后台开发技术模拟整体效果,丰富互联网Web开发,致力于通过技术提升用户体验。
什么是web?网络就是万维网,完全解释这个术语需要一些空间。这里用一句话概括,就是它是一个全球公认的协议,一个信息系统,上网前必须遵守这个协议。Web前端其实就是前端,或者说前端技术和前端开发。这些名词有相似的意思。前端网络编程使用的工具可以用于前端编程。了解这些工具最适合什么任务有助于产生高质量和可伸缩的站点。
1.超文本标记语言:
HTML是任何网页工程程序的骨架,没有它网页就不存在。超文本标记语言可以提供网站的整体外观。HTML是TimBerners-Lee开发的。随着超文本标记语言的发展,万维网上已经产生了许多版本。超文本标记语言的最新版本,称为HTML5,由W3C于2014年10月28日推出。
这个版本包含新的和有效的方法来传输元素,如音频和视频文件。H5在前端工程师中很受欢迎。HTML5和老版本相比,有很多特点。随着HTML的发展,网络发生了一场革命。
2.堆叠样式列表(CSS)。
CSS控制网站的外观,让网站有自己独特的外观。它的实现形式是保证样式列表先于其他样式规则,并受其他输入形式的影响,比如屏幕大小和分辨率。
3、JavaScript。
JavaScript (JS)是一种基于场景的命令式语言(不同于HTML的描述性语言),用来使静态的HTML界面动态化。JS代码可以使用HTML标准提供的文档对象模型(DOM)根据事件(比如用户输入)来操纵网页。
JS使用了一种叫做异步JavaScript和XML (AJAX)的技术。JS代码还可以动态改变网页的内容(独立于原HTML页面),还可以响应服务器端的事件,使得网页体验增加了真实的动态特性。
JS中有很多流行的开发框架,帮助开发者快速构建网页。比如Vue.js,Angular,React都是比较流行的框架,拥有大量的忠实用户。
4.操作系统
了解Unix和Linux的基础知识,对开发者是有好处的。
5.网络服务器
了解Web服务器,包括Apache的基本配置和对htaccess配置技巧的掌握。
本文转载自中文网站
18
2022-10
07
2022-10
30
2022-09
15
2022-09
15
2022-09
15
2022-09